Meet Ivy Fu, Our Ballsbridge Caregiver of the Year
This year, every Dovida office across the country was asked to nominate a Caregiver of the Year. Dovida Ballsbridge covers the busy urban centres of Dublin 2, 4, 6, 8.

Can you tell us about yourself?
My name in Mandrain is Yuwei Fu but everyone calls me Ivy at work. I came to Dublin to study in college and start this job after graduation. I grew up in north-eastern part of China, in a city near seaside. So kinda like here in Dublin and I am used to it.
When did you become a Caregiver?
I started this job after finishing college in Dublin. I am close to my grandparents, and I find I love spending time with elderly people. So, I decide to try this job and here I am. And I enjoy working as a caregiver now.

What does being a Caregiver mean to you?
It gives me chance to know more about local Irish culture and local people. I love meeting different clients and enjoy helping them when they need a hand. I feel I am not just working for them, but developing relationships through it, I learn from their experience and advice as well. So, it does not only mean me offering help, but I receive their kindness at the same time.
